CMA 11
CMA 11 complies with the highest level of ISO classification, Secondary Standard. Is recommended for scientific applications, for which accuracy needs to be according to the highest standards. The lightweight design makes CMA albedometers ideal for portable applications such as on snow and ice fields
The white sun shield prevents the body of the albedometer from heating up. The conical lower glare screen prevents direct illumination of the lower glass dome at sunrise and sunset.
A bubble level is fitted and a screw-in drying cartridge keeps the interior free from humidity. The signal cable has a waterproof connector for ease of installation. All albedometers are supplied with a calibration certificate traceable to the World Radiation Centre.
